3

カスタム アクションを使用して、インストールの前にいくつかのチェックを行っています。これらのチェックが失敗した場合、インストールが開始されないようにしたい。

これを優雅に行う方法はありますか?

4

1 に答える 1

5

要素を使用してチェックを実行できない場合Conditionは、カスタム アクションでActionResult.Failure、チェックが失敗した場合に戻るActionResult.Successか、チェックに合格した場合に戻る必要があります。

Failure を返すと、セットアップが RollBack モードになり、それ以上進行しなくなります。これは、 CustomAction要素のReturn属性がデフォルトであるに設定されている場合に機能します。check

于 2013-08-02T11:06:36.127 に答える